Let me put something into perspective for you.

Last season Saquon Barkley scored 24.1 ppg and the RB12-14 in points per game last were LF, Marlon Mack, and Phillip Lindsay all hovering between 14.5-15ppg.

George Kittle scored 16.2 ppg last season where the TE12 (Kyle Rudolph) scored 9.5ppg. The difference between the top scoring RB in the league and the bottom RB1 vs Kittle (3rd and a TON of room to grow) and the 12th TE was only a 3 point positional advantage. Kelce/Ertz/Kittle are so undervalued its crazy. You're practically getting the positional advantage of an ELITE RB for half the price.

None of this takes into account that 1. Reed is worthless since being on the sideline doesn't get you any points, ASJ has never been fantasy relevant and is coming off 2 mediocre seasons. DJ is a stud and he proved that by miraculously finishing as a top 12 RB in that horrid offense but KJ wasn't THAT far behind him as a rookie who is poised to take on a much larger role. Not to mention you're trading 2 very young and promising players for a RB going on his age 27 season...RB's hit the cliff a lot sooner than WR and the cliff typically comes out of nowhere so I think it's dumb to overpay to get a RB in that age range unless its a complete steal of a trade.
